For guests who want to go past Bhutan's western valleys entirely and into the country's rarely visited east — from the sacred sites of Paro, through the temple valleys of Bumthang, across long scenic drives to Trashigang and Trashiyangtse, and finally on foot into the remote Brokpa homelands of Merak and Sakteng. This is a physically demanding itinerary, best suited to fit, experienced travelers comfortable with several consecutive days of exertion and rustic homestay conditions.

Highlights

  • Merak and Sakteng homestays with Brokpa host families
  • A high-altitude trek to Jomokungkhar at 4,500m
  • A night at a yak herders' camp on the way to Tsolung Goenpa
  • The Tang Valley trek past the Drapham ruins
  • A hike to Thowadra Monastery
  • Gomakora Lhakhang and the ancient Golomzur / Jamkhar chorten
  • An acclimatisation hike to Zuri Dzong and a full day to Chumpu Nye
  • A choice of farewell hikes — Tiger's Nest, Bumdra, or Dragey Pangtsho

The route

Where this journey goes

The places this journey moves through, in order. Day-by-day timings are confirmed with you when we build your dates.

  1. 1

    Paro

    An acclimatisation hike to Zuri Dzong, and a full day to Chumpu Nye

  2. 2By air

    Bumthang

    Fly Paro–Bumthang, into the temple valleys

  3. 3

    Tang Valley

    The Tang Valley trek, past the Drapham ruins

  4. 4

    Thowadra

    The hike up to Thowadra Monastery

  5. 5

    Mongar

    The long drive east, over Thrumshingla

  6. 6

    Trashigang

    Gomakora Lhakhang, on the road north

  7. 7

    Trashiyangtse

    The ancient Golomzur / Jamkhar chorten

  8. 8

    Merak

    On foot into the Brokpa homelands, inside Sakteng Wildlife Sanctuary

  9. 9

    Sakteng

    Jomokungkhar at 4,500m, and a yak herders' camp below Tsolung Goenpa

  10. 10By air

    Taktsang

    Fly Yongphula–Paro, and close with Tiger's Nest, Bumdra or Dragey Pangtsho
